3.7 Electromagnetic compatibility

EMC interference
immunity

Acc. to EN 61000-6-2 (industrial
environment)

EMC interference
emission

Acc. to EN 55022 (Class B, household
environment)

If several devices are switched in parallel on the mains side so
that the line current of the arrangement is in the range of 16 - 75
A, then this arrangement conforms to IEC 61000-3-12 provided
that the short-circuit power S

sc

at the connection point of the

customer system to the public power system is greater than or
equal to 120 times the rated output of the arrangement.
It is the responsibility of the installation engineer or operator/
owner of the device to ensure, if necessary after consultation
with the network operator, that this device is only connected to
a connection point with a S

sc

value that is greater than or equal

to 120 times the rated output of the arrangement.

4. CONNECTION AND START-UP

4.1 Connecting the mechanical system

CAUTION
Cutting and crushing hazard when removing the device
from the packaging

Blades can be bent
→ Carefully remove the device from its packaging, only

touching the wall ring. Make sure to avoid any shock.

→ Wear safety shoes and cut-resistant safety gloves.

CAUTION
Heavy load when taking out the device

Bodily harm, e.g. back injuries, are possible.
→ Two people should remove the device out of its packaging

together.

;

Check the device for transport damage. Damaged devices must no
longer be installed.

;

Install the undamaged device according to your application.

4.2 Connecting the electrical system

DANGER
Electric voltage on the device

Electric shock
→ Always install a protective earth first.
→ Check the protective earth.

DANGER
Incorrect insulation

Risk of fatal injury from electric shock
→ Use only cables that meet the specified installation

requirements for voltage, current, insulation material, load etc.

→ Route cables such that they cannot be touched by any

rotating parts.

DANGER
Electrical load (>50 µC) between mains wire and
protective earth connection after switching of the supply
when switching multiple devices in parallel.

Electric shock, risk of injury
→ Make sure that sufficient protection against accidental contact

is provided.
Before working on the electrical connection, the
connections to the mains supply and PE must be shorted.

CAUTION
Electrical voltage

The fan is a built-in component and features no electrically
isolating switch.
→ Only connect the fan to circuits that can be switched off with

an all-pole separating switch.

→ When working on the fan, you must switch off the

installation/machine in which the fan is installed and secure it
from being switched on again.

NOTE
Interferences and failures are possible

Maintain a distance to the power supply line when routing the
control lines of the device.
